About this project
What does Armor Overlay add?
Changes the armor bar to show the full range of possible armor levels from 0 to 30.
With the addition of the generic.armor attribute in 1.9 it's possible for armor to give partial point however the vanilla armor bar can only show full armor points. By default Armor Overlay shows each 0.25 point with each full piece of armor on the bar is worth one armor point and shows in 1/4 armor piece rather than the vanilla version where each one piece of armor shown is two points and will show 1/2 pieces.
The config can be set to a max of showing each 0.04167 point.
To fix the damage calc so the partial points are actually useful you can use my Armor Recalc mod.
1.7.10 version
Changes the armor bar to show gold for each point above diamond you are. If you get full gold than it starts Diamond. Config allows using 1/4 rather than 1/2 or even 1 full armor display per point or to go from leather up.
Also allows for a text display of the armor value.
Intended for use with Armor recalc mod that I was never actually able to get working with it crashing with powered armor.
